About this artwork

This oil painting by Vincent van Gogh depicts a rugged, rocky landscape, characterized by the artist's distinctive thick impasto and vibrant brushwork. It captures a segment of the natural world, likely from his period in Provence, reflecting his intense engagement with the environment.

Did you know?

Vincent van Gogh's 'Rocks' exemplifies his groundbreaking approach to landscape painting, where he used color and brushstroke not just to represent, but to express emotion and energy. This painting likely dates from his time in Arles or Saint-Rémy, periods of intense creativity where he sought to capture the raw, untamed beauty of the Provençal landscape through his unique vision, making the rocks and foliage pulsate with life.
